form_tag

http://blog.csdn.net/chunyang_guo/article/details/12779765

 

 

 

 

  1. 有对应 Model 的时候用 form_for,没有就用 form_tag,比如搜索框一般没有对应 Model。  


 

 

 
    1. <%= form_tag controller: "static_pages", action: "change", method: "post" do %>  
    2.     <label for="oldpassword">Old Password</label><br>  
    3.     <%= password_field_tag :old_password,params[:old_password] %><br>  
    4.     <label for="new_password">New Password</label><br>  
    5.     <%= password_field_tag :new_password,params[:new_password] %><br>  
    6.     <label for="Password Confirm">Password Confirm</label><br>  
    7.     <%= password_field_tag :password_confirm, params[:password_confirm] %><br>  
    8.   
    9.     <%= submit_tag 'Change Password' %>  
    10. <% end %>  
posted @ 2015-08-07 07:41  梅西爸爸  阅读(297)  评论(0编辑  收藏  举报